Phoenix, an Active Management Area in the desert Southwest US, is the 5 th most populated city in the US. Scarce local groundwater and water transported from external resources must be managed in the presence of different types of energy sources. Local and regional dec.sion-makers are faced with answering challenging questions on managing water, energy supply, and demand over a few years to several dec.des. Prediction and planning for the interdependency of these entities can benefit from modeling the water and energy sys.ems as well as their interactions with one another. In this paper, the integrated WEAP and LEAP tools and a modeling framework that externalizes their hidden linkage to an interaction model are described and comp.red using the Phoenix AMA. Loose coupling enabled by interaction modeling is a key for dec.sion-policies that should be grounded at the nexus of the water-energy sys.em of sys.ems.
